How Online Education Can Inspire Authentic Sustainable Practices

Kadenze

Flipped Courses : students view lecture content before a class, then spend in-class time on more active learning interactions with the instructor and students. By starting to integrate digital learning tools into classroom and curricula, we can reduce our ecological footprints and encourage more sustainability.
